CHTF18 is an evolutionarily conserved protein and an essential subunit of the Replication Factor C-like complex (CTF18-RLC). It coordinates DNA replication, repair, and cohesion establishment during cell division, safeguarding chromosomal integrity. CHTF18 is involved in ATP-dependent loading of PCNA onto DNA, modulation of DNA polymerase activity, and activation of the replication stress response. It plays key roles in chromosome transmission fidelity, especially in germline development and meiosis, and its deregulation is associated with subfertility and cancer due to genome instability. CHTF18 interacts with CTF8, DCC1, RFC2, RFC3, RFC4, RFC5, PCNA, and DNA polymerase POLH, functioning centrally in genome maintenance and chromatid cohesion during S phase and metaphase-anaphase transition.
Not applicable (no approved drugs target CHTF18 directly); inhibitor/modulator mechanism would theoretically affect DNA replication, chromatid cohesion, or cell cycle checkpoint activation
